Dawn Explosive final in prospect today
Rehan Siddiqui - 4 November 2001

On paper Pakistan and Sri Lanka are 'even stevens' and Sunday's Khaleej Times Trophy final is between two well- matched sides loaded with explosive individuals capable of changing the fortune of the match.

In earlier two league outings the honours have been shared. Sri Lanka outplayed Pakistan in every facet of the game to win the first match by seven wickets.

Pakistan evened the score by winning the second encounter by the identical margin although faced a much stiffer target.

Will it be Sanath Jayasuriya holding aloft the trophy for the second successive time or Waqar Younis leading Pakistan to victory stand for the first time since taking the leadership mantle is anybody's guess?

Pakistan, rightly considered as the most unpredictable side, are good enough to beat the best on their day if perform to their talent. But in recent times the Pakistanis have become chokers specially when competing in the finals.

The Sri Lankans on the other hand are better organized than their more talented rivals and have the psychological edge over Pakistan having beaten them in last April's final.

While Pakistan rely on individuals brilliance for victory the Sri Lankans work as a unit hoping everyone to chip in with useful performances.

Both teams rested their best players for Friday's tie but will be at full strength. Champion off-spinner Muttiah Muralitharan will be back to tantalize Pakistani batsmen probably at the expense of Prabath Nissanka. So will be demon pace bowler Wasim Akram and classy Saeed Anwar for Pakistan. All-rounder Azhar Mahmood and off-spinner Shoaib Malik are likely to make way for the two battle-hardened veterans.

As the pitch is expected to be batsman-friendly a high scoring final is predicted.

Teams (from):

Pakistan: Waqar Younis (captain), Saeed Anwar, Inzamam-ul- Haq, Yousuf Youhana, Younis Khan, Shahid Afridi, Shoaib Akhtar, Abdur Razzaq, Naved Latif, Rashid Latif, Wasim Akram, Shoaib Malik, Azhar Mahmood.

Sri Lanka: Sanath Jayasuriya (captain), Avishka Gunawardena, Marvan Atapattu, Mahela Jayawardena, Russel Arnold, Kumar Sangakkara, Romesh Kaluwitharana, Kumar Dharmasena, Chaminda Vaas, Charith Buddhika, Muttiah Muralitharan, Prabath Nissanka, Dulip Liyanage.
